Three times per week Australia's most successful lure fishermen share their secrets for catching Australia's iconic sports species. The Australian Lure Fishing Podcast (ALF) is on a mission to help everyday fishermen experience better fishing than they could ever have imagined. Host Greg "Doc Lures" Vinall hand picks the cream of Aussie fishermen and presses them to give up the tips that matter. It's no fluff, no nonsense, top notch fishing info. Bonus: The Reef Builder Program With Dr Chris Gillies 27.10.2020 34:43
Most estuary anglers would be well aware of the importance of oyster encrusted rocks as habitat for many of our popular angling species. But few realise the massive depletion of oyster reefs that's occurred over the past century - they're now just a fraction of what they once where.
